An ancient skeleton (representational). Source: Idanthyrs / Adobe Stock.

Ancient Remains of Disabled Teenage Girl Unearthed in Brazil

A remarkable archaeological discovery in Brazil's Serra das Confusões National Park has unveiled the centuries-old remains of a disabled teenage girl, whose life was marked by spina bifida. Unearthed...